Silence of the Lands

Collecting ambient sounds in the natural environment

This activity is called data catching. By means of a PDA application named "Sound Camera," ambient sounds are collected from the natural environment, linked to the person that collected them, and associated to GPS data. These data will determine the location in space and time of the recorded sounds and allow them to be visualized on a GIS map.
